Buy one of those cheap PC Remote's with serial IR Receiver on e-bay for like 7 bucks, throw the remote away, and get a 15-2116 from Radio Shack. I've done it three times for different machines.

There are many threads on "favorite universal remote", but for some
reason I'm having trouble with the other half of that equation:
something to plug into my PC to *receive* the signals from the remote
control of choice.

The only stuff I've found on the web is:

        - Build-your-own serial-port IR receiver.
        - Hauppage WinTV-PVR cards apparently have a remote control
          included with them.
        - IRMan: http://www.evation.com/irman/

I have an HD-3000 (which did not come with a remote control), so the
Hauppage remote control solution does not apply to me.

I feel like I'm being really dense or something. The only other thing
I can think of is that people just buy some cheap wireless keyboard
and configure a remote to send signals to the keyboard's IR receiver.
But in my experience, the range on wireless keyboards isn't that
great, so it seems of limited applicability in a large living room.

Can someone give me a starting point for something to receive the
signals from a remote control for an HD-3000-based MythTV system?
